I like this style. The very rectangular shaped ones never look terribly comfortable and the attraction of a bath is to be able to lie back and relax.
www.appliancesdirect.co.uk/Images/MFSB05_1_Supersize.jpg?width=700&height=700&v=1

Think carefully about where you position it in terms of access to plumbing/pipes if anything goes wrong and also how you can clean around/behind it. A friend has hers angled in a corner and has to climb into the bath to clean down the back of it. Hers is completely glued to the floor so it's not a simple case of re-positioning it.
